Output 50760c5bc6411541471a0d4306c5aedae8ddbc548d9e75ae71679bfa0c7ea65d:0

value
5438930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c7c74f3e56b90ad2824b61ab820acd51e92e58a OP_EQUAL
address
3LLEs6CZ3yKsyN7f61aeuAY1LzDDS99RZm
transaction
50760c5bc6411541471a0d4306c5aedae8ddbc548d9e75ae71679bfa0c7ea65d
spent
true